There is a packed schedule of events, activities and support planned to keep families across Newcastle entertained this summer.
The City Council has joined forces with over 100 providers to offer the ‘Best Holiday Ever’ programme of activities eligible for Free School Meals. The sessions include indoor and outdoor games, cookery skills, arts and crafts, sports, fitness and dance, health and well being, quizzes, park activities, nature trails and more – all of which include a healthy meal.
In the Kenton district CHEF, Inspire Youth, JJ Coaching, NE Youth, Kenton Park Sports Centre and Hat Trick will be delivering summer long programmes from July 24 to September 2023.
In addition, over 16,000 youngsters will benefit from free food vouchers as part of the Council’s continued support to help families most in need during the holidays.
Festival experience
This summer will also bring a brand-new festival experience taking place from 11-13 August. The event, called NOVUM, will showcase local, national and international talent and transform the Civic Centre and surrounding gardens into a cultural playground, where audiences can make, explore and engage with art, music, performances and installations.

Everyone deserves a good break and school holidays are better when there’s a great choice of things to do to keep children and young people active, having fun, being entertained and learning new things.
A part of the Holiday Activities and Food (HAF) programme, Newcastle’s Best Summer Ever helps children, young people and their parents have fulfilling, active, fun-filled and healthy school holidays. It is funded by the Depart for Education for families eligible for free school meals.
